The treatment of hair loss depends on the underlying cause.Some causes are treatable while others are not.Possible causes of hair loss may include:
-Genetic factors
-
Hormonal changes
-
Scalp infection
-Some medications
-Certain hairstyles and treatment
-Aging
Effective treatments for some types of hair loss are available. But some hair loss is permanent.
Rogaine is a medication well known to treat pattern
baldness just like what just describe.With this treatment, some people experience hair regrowth, a slower rate of hair loss or both. The effect peaks at 16 weeks and you need to keep applying the medication to retain benefits.I think you may give this drug a try.
If Roagaine does not help you, you may have to resort to other treatment options like surgery,
laser therapy, and wigs or hairpieces.I will also recommend the following:
-Eat a nutritionally balanced diet.
-Avoid tight hairstyles, such as braids, buns or ponytails.
-Avoid compulsively twisting, rubbing or pulling your hair.
-Treat your hair gently when washing and brushing.
-Avoid harsh treatments.
